drjobs Senior Kafka / Java Developer

Senior Kafka / Java Developer

Employer Active

1 Vacancy
drjobs

Job Alert

You will be updated with latest job alerts via email
Valid email field required
Send jobs
Send me jobs like this
drjobs

Job Alert

You will be updated with latest job alerts via email

Valid email field required
Send jobs
Job Location drjobs

Baltimore, MD - USA

Monthly Salary drjobs

$ 104650 - 189175

Vacancy

1 Vacancy

Job Description

The Digital Modernization Sector has an opening for a Senior Kafka/Java Developer to work in Woodlawn MD.

This position will require onsite work in Woodlawn MD five days a week.

DAY TO DAY RESPONSIBILITIES:

  • Architect design develop and implement nextgeneration data streaming and eventbased architecture / platform using software engineering best practices in the latest technologies:

    • Data Streaming Event Driven Architecture Event Processing Frameworks.

    • DevOps (Jenkins Red Hat OpenShift Docker SonarQube).

    • InfrastructureasCode and ConfigurationasCode (Ansible Terraform / CloudFormation Scripting).

  • Provide software expertise in one or more of these areas: eventdriven architecture application integration serviceoriented architectures (SOA) security business process management/business rules processing CI/CD pipeline and containerization or data ingestion/data modeling.

  • Investigate and repair application defects regardless of component: Kafka Platform business logic middleware or database (PL/SQL and Data Modeling).

  • Brief management customer team or vendors using written or oral skills at appropriate technical level for audience.

  • All other duties as assigned or directed.

FOUNDATION FOR SUCCESS (Required Qualifications):

  • Bachelors Degree in Computer Science Mathematics Engineering OR a related field with 8 years of relevant experience OR Masters degree with 6 years of relevant experience. Additional years of relevant experience maybe accepted or considered in lieu of degree.

  • 8 years of combined experience with modern software development (Examples: Java with Spring Boot Python and/or C# with .Net Core).

  • 4 years of combined experience with Kafka (One or more of the following: Confluent Kafka Apache Kafka and/or Amazon MSK).

  • 2 years of combined experience data streaming developing eventdriven applications and/or event processing frameworks (Examples: Kafka Streams Apache Flink and/or ksqlDB).

  • Must be able to obtain and maintain a Public Trust Security Clearance. Contract requirement.

FACTORS TO HELP YOU SHINE (Required Qualifications):

These skills will help you succeed in this position:

  • Competence with multiple modern programming languages and frameworks including Java with Spring and at least one other.

  • Understanding of Domain Driven Design (DDD) and experience applying DDD patterns in software development.

  • Practical experience with eventdriven applications and at least one event processing framework such as Kafka Streams Apache Flink and/or ksqlDB.

  • Experience working with Kafka connectors and/or development with the Kafka Connect API.

  • Experience with Avro data serialization and schema governance.

  • Experience developing applications for PaaS (Red Hat OpenShift and/or Kubernetes) and Docker containers.

  • Basic understanding of DevOps and tools (Git/Bitbucket CI/CD pipelines Jenkins SonarQube).

  • Experience with API development & monitoring tools (Ready API Swagger Splunk Dynatrace).

  • Experience working on Agile projects and understanding Agile terminology.

HOW TO STAND OUT FROM THE CROWD (Desired Qualifications):

Showcase your knowledge of modern development through the following experience or skills:

  • Preferred experience with AWS cloud technologies or other cloud platforms; AWS cloud certifications.

  • Experience with InfrastructureasCode and ConfigurationasCode (Ansible CloudFormation / Terraform Scripting).

  • Solid experience with automated unit testing TDD BDD and associated technologies (Junit Mockito Cucumber Selenium and Karma/Jasmine).

  • Solid knowledge of relational databases (PostgreSQL DB2 or Oracle) SQL and ORM technologies (JPA2 Hibernate or Spring JPA).

Original Posting:

May 2 2025

For U.S. Positions: While subject to change based on business needs Leidos reasonably anticipates that this job requisition will remain open for at least 3 days with an anticipated close date of no earlier than 3 days after the original posting date as listed above.

Pay Range:

Pay Range $104650.00 $189175.00

The Leidos pay range for this job level is a general guideline onlyand not a guarantee of compensation or salary. Additional factors considered in extending an offer include (but are not limited to) responsibilities of the job education experience knowledge skills and abilities as well as internal equity alignment with market data applicable bargaining agreement (if any) or other law.


Required Experience:

Senior IC

Employment Type

Full-Time

Company Industry

About Company

Report This Job
Disclaimer: Drjobpro.com is only a platform that connects job seekers and employers. Applicants are advised to conduct their own independent research into the credentials of the prospective employer.We always make certain that our clients do not endorse any request for money payments, thus we advise against sharing any personal or bank-related information with any third party. If you suspect fraud or malpractice, please contact us via contact us page.